What companies run services between Leuven, Belgium and Hintertux, Austria?

You can take a train from Louvain to Hintertux Feuerwehr via Liège-Guillemins, München Ost, Ostbahnhof, Jenbach, Mayrhofen Im Zillertal, and Mayrhofen Bahnhof C in around 16h 6m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Leuven Wijnpers to Hintertux Feuerwehr via Brussel Noord afstaphalte, Brussels-North train station, Munich central bus station, Jenbach Bahnhof B, and Mayrhofen Bahnhof C in around 20h 57m.
